> I checked our fullbkup store options. We are using "ONLINE", but without
> an option of "START" or "END". According to the Manual:
>
> If no parameters are specified for ONLINE, the sync point automatically
> occurs at the beginning of the backup, and an online backup is performed
> where all files must be closed for write access at that time."
>
> The initiation of a 7x24 true-online backup with a logically consistent
> sync point is controlled by the START or END parameter with the ONLINE
> option. Backups created with the START parameter have the sync point at
> the beginning of the backup. Backups created with the END parameter have
> the sync point at the end of the backup.
>
> If I'm reading this correctly, we're fine, as the files are closed prior
> to backup. Your opinion would be appreciated...

> Important notice for HP TurboStore customers
>
>
> Dear HP TurboStore customer,
>
>
> HP has recently learned about a problem in our
> TurboStore product, which can affect your ability
> to successfully recover certain files from a backup.
>
> This problem has been fixed with a new patch MPELXR9,
> which is available in the following versions:
>
> MPELXR9-A for MPE/iX 6.5
> MPELXR9-B for MPE/iX 7.0
>
> Systems on MPE/iX 6.0 are not affected by this problem.
>
> This patch has been intensively and successfully tested
> inhouse and at several beta sites, and is now available
> as general release patch from your Response Center and
> the ITRC.
>
> Technical details about the circumstances of this problem
> are appended to this message. To avoid this problem, HP
> recommends you to install this patch at your earliest
> convenient time.
>
> If you have any archive or off-site critical backups which
> were created using online=start you should consider
> re-creating them once the patch is installed.
>
> Please contact your HP Response Center, if you have
> any additional questions.

> TurboStore ONLINE=START silently fails to backup files on 6.5 and 7.0
>
> TurboStore silently fails to backup data for certain files
> under the following combined circumstances:
>
> - STORE with ;ONLINE=START option only
> - Files which are not attached to Transaction Manager
> (TurboImage databases, KSAMXL, KSAM64 and user XM attached
> files not affected; Allbase/SQL DBE's are not attached
> to transaction manager and may therefore be affected)
> - Files that are NOT large files (Files whose maximum possible
> size is less than 4Gb)
> - Files must be open during the sync point
> - Files must be closed (by all processes) between the
> end of sync point and the point where they are written
> onto the media
>
> If these conditions match, then TurboStore will only write the
> file label onto the backup media, but no data contents are stored.
>
> No error message is generated in the STORE listing.
